Jalapeño Poppers (Cream Cheese, No Leak)

Jalapeños halved and stuffed with a stabilised cream cheese filling in a 2:1 ratio with shredded cheese, breaded on top only, and baked or air fried so the filling sets without leaking.

Ingredients
  

For the poppers
  • 10 jalapeños 3 to 4 inches, firm, halved lengthwise, seeded
  • 8 oz cream cheese room temperature
  • 4 oz sharp cheddar or pepper jack shredded
  • 2 tbsp finely grated Parmesan
  • 2 tbsp plain breadcrumbs
  • 1 small garlic clove grated
  • 1 green onion minced
  • 1/2 tsp kosher salt
  • 1/4 tsp black pepper
  • 4 strips cooked bacon finely chopped, optional
For the topping
  • 1/2 cup flour
  • 2 eggs beaten
  • 1 cup panko
  • 1 tbsp oil
  • 1/2 tsp smoked paprika
  • 1/4 tsp salt

Method
 

  1. Halve through the stem, scoop seeds and ribs, rinse, and pat very dry inside and out.
  2. Beat the cream cheese with the cheddar, Parmesan, breadcrumbs, garlic, green onion, salt, pepper, and bacon.
  3. Fill each half level with the rim, not mounded.
  4. Dust the cut surface only with flour, dip the filling side in egg, then press into the seasoned panko.
  5. Oven: 425°F, 14 to 17 minutes. Air fryer: 375°F, 8 to 10 minutes, until the edges blister and the filling just puffs.

Notes

2:1 cream cheese to shredded cheese, plus a dry binder is what keeps the filling from breaking.
Fill level, not mounded — overfilled poppers dome and split.
Filling soupy? Stir in another tablespoon of breadcrumbs and chill 15 minutes.
